Polarization Division Multiplexing Emulator Market Overview and Report Coverage
Polarization Division Multiplexing (PDM) Emulator is a crucial tool in the telecommunications industry for testing and verifying the performance of PDM systems. This advanced technology allows for the seamless integration and emulation of multiple polarization states in optical communication networks, enabling the simulation of real-world scenarios and optimizing network performance.

Polarization Division Multiplexing Emulator Market Dynamics ( Drivers, Restraints, Opportunity, Challenges)
Polarization Division Multiplexing (PDM) Emulator market is driven by the increasing demand for high-speed data transmission in telecommunication networks. The adoption of PDM technology enhances the capacity and efficiency of optical communication systems, thereby fueling market growth. However, the market faces restraints such as the high cost associated with PDM emulators and the complexities in integrating PDM technology with existing networks. The opportunities lie in the development of advanced PDM emulators to meet the evolving requirements of the communication industry. Challenges include the need for standardization and interoperability of PDM emulators across different networks.
